Healthcare is shifting toward faster, more accessible, and patient-centered services, and diagnostic testing is at the heart of this transformation. Traditional lab testing often involves long wait times and multiple visits, which can delay treatment decisions. Point-of-care diagnostics are changing this by enabling immediate testing and results at or near the patient’s location. This shift is significantly contributing to the expansion of the Point of Care Diagnostics Testing Market across global healthcare systems.
Point-of-care testing devices are widely used in clinics, hospitals, and even home care settings. These devices allow healthcare professionals to perform tests quickly without sending samples to centralized laboratories. This reduces turnaround time and improves efficiency.
Another major advantage is early diagnosis. Rapid test results enable doctors to make quicker decisions regarding treatment, which can be critical in emergency situations or infectious disease management.
As healthcare systems continue to prioritize speed and convenience, point-of-care diagnostics are becoming essential tools for delivering timely and effective patient care.

What is point-of-care diagnostics testing?
It refers to medical diagnostic testing performed at or near the patient’s location, providing immediate results without the need for centralized laboratories.
Why is point-of-care testing important?
It enables faster diagnosis, improves patient outcomes, and enhances healthcare efficiency.
Where are point-of-care diagnostic devices used?
They are used in hospitals, clinics, home care settings, and emergency care environments.
What technologies are used in point-of-care diagnostics?
Technologies include portable devices, biosensors, artificial intelligence, and data analytics.
